Docs.rs
cpal-0.15.2
cpal 0.15.2
Docs.rs crate page
Apache-2.0
Links
Documentation
Repository
Crates.io
Source
Owners
tomaka
github:rustaudio:cpal-maintainers
Dependencies
dasp_sample ^0.11
normal
anyhow ^1.0
dev
clap ^4.0
dev
hound ^3.5
dev
ringbuf ^0.3
dev
js-sys ^0.3.35
normal
wasm-bindgen ^0.2.58
normal
web-sys ^0.3.35
normal
alsa ^0.7
normal
jack ^0.11
normal
libc ^0.2
normal
parking_lot ^0.12
normal
core-foundation-sys ^0.8.2
normal
mach2 ^0.4
normal
parking_lot ^0.12
normal
jni ^0.19
normal
ndk ^0.7
normal
ndk-context ^0.1
normal
oboe ^0.5
normal
ndk-glue ^0.7
dev
js-sys ^0.3.35
normal
wasm-bindgen ^0.2.58
normal
wasm-bindgen-futures ^0.4.33
normal
web-sys ^0.3.35
normal
coreaudio-rs ^0.11
normal
coreaudio-rs ^0.11
normal
asio-sys ^0.2
normal
num-traits ^0.2.6
normal
once_cell ^1.12
normal
parking_lot ^0.12
normal
windows ^0.46.0
normal
Versions
75.9%
of the crate is documented
Go to latest version
Platform
i686-pc-windows-msvc
x86_64-pc-windows-msvc
x86_64-unknown-linux-gnu
Feature flags
Rust
About docs.rs
Privacy policy
Rust website
The Book
Standard Library API Reference
Rust by Example
The Cargo Guide
Clippy Documentation
☰
SizedSample
Required Associated Constants
FORMAT
Implementations on Foreign Types
f32
f64
i16
i32
i64
i8
u16
u32
u64
u8
Implementors
In cpal
?
Trait
cpal
::
SizedSample
source
·
[
−
]
pub trait SizedSample:
Sample
{ const
FORMAT
:
SampleFormat
; }
Required Associated Constants
§
source
const
FORMAT
:
SampleFormat
Implementations on Foreign Types
§
source
§
impl
SizedSample
for
u64
source
§
const
FORMAT
:
SampleFormat
= SampleFormat::U64
source
§
impl
SizedSample
for
i16
source
§
const
FORMAT
:
SampleFormat
= SampleFormat::I16
source
§
impl
SizedSample
for
i8
source
§
const
FORMAT
:
SampleFormat
= SampleFormat::I8
source
§
impl
SizedSample
for
i32
source
§
const
FORMAT
:
SampleFormat
= SampleFormat::I32
source
§
impl
SizedSample
for
u8
source
§
const
FORMAT
:
SampleFormat
= SampleFormat::U8
source
§
impl
SizedSample
for
f64
source
§
const
FORMAT
:
SampleFormat
= SampleFormat::F64
source
§
impl
SizedSample
for
f32
source
§
const
FORMAT
:
SampleFormat
= SampleFormat::F32
source
§
impl
SizedSample
for
u32
source
§
const
FORMAT
:
SampleFormat
= SampleFormat::U32
source
§
impl
SizedSample
for
u16
source
§
const
FORMAT
:
SampleFormat
= SampleFormat::U16
source
§
impl
SizedSample
for
i64
source
§
const
FORMAT
:
SampleFormat
= SampleFormat::I64
Implementors
§